Exchange Rate Application
After establishing the USD trade-in value, the calculator fetches current cryptocurrency prices from exchange APIs or price aggregators. It divides the trade-in dollar amount by the current crypto price to determine equivalent cryptocurrency quantity. For example, a $520 iPhone trade-in divided by Bitcoin’s $2,750 price equals 0.189 BTC, while the same $520 divided by Ethereum’s $210 price yields 2.476 ETH.
Calculation Formula Breakdown
The core formula is simple: Crypto Value = Trade-In USD / Cryptocurrency Price USD. Advanced calculators also factor in transaction fees, bid-ask spreads, and potential slippage for large transactions. Some tools display both “theoretical” values using mid-market rates and “practical” values accounting for 0.5-2% in combined fees when actually converting to cryptocurrency.

Apple Store Credit Conversion Challenges
Apple’s official trade-in provides store credit rather than cash, limiting direct cryptocurrency conversion options. Secondary gift card markets like Raise or CardCash buy Apple Store credit at 10-25% discounts, with proceeds then convertible to cryptocurrency through exchanges. This two-step process erodes value significantly, making Apple Store credit suboptimal for users prioritizing cryptocurrency conversion over ecosystem convenience.
Third-Party Cash Payment Routes
Platforms like Gazelle, Decluttr, and Swappa pay cash for Apple devices, with funds deposited via PayPal, check, or bank transfer within 5-10 days. Once cash hits your account, transfer to cryptocurrency exchanges like Coinbase or Kraken for conversion to Bitcoin, Ethereum, or preferred digital assets. This adds 5-10 days to the conversion timeline but preserves more value than gift card resale discount routes.
